Media Release: House meets tomorrow



AN EXTRADITION AGREEMENT BETWEEN SAINT LUCIA AND THE FRENCH REPUBLIC IS ONE OF THE BILLS TO BE DISCUSSED.
by Office of the Parliament

A Sitting of the House of Assembly is scheduled for Tuesday, Nov. 20, with Papers to be laid by the Honourable Prime Minister and Minister for Finance, Economic Growth, Job Creation, External Affairs and the Public Service, the Honourable Minister for Commerce, Industry, Investment, Enterprise Development and Consumer Affairs, the Honourable Minister for Tourism, Information, Broadcasting, Culture and Creative Industries and the Honourable Minister for Equity, Social Justice, Local Government and Empowerment.

The Motion for consideration is as follows:

BE IT RESOLVED that Parliament authorises the Minister for Finance to borrow from the Caribbean Development Bank an amount not exceeding US$4,927,210.00, consisting of a Special Funds Resources portion in the amount of US$2,463,605.00 and an Ordinary Capital Resources portion in the amount of US$2,463,605.00 for the purpose of financing the Services of Consultants to conduct Implementation (LABs) Workshops and to set up a Performance Management and Delivery Unit.

The following Bills are down for consideration:

1. Companies (Amendment)

2. International Trust (Amendment)

3. Income Tax (Amendment)

4. International Business Companies (Amendment)

5. International Partnership (Amendment)

6. Automatic Exchange of Financial Account Information (Amendment)

7. Agreement on Extradition (Saint Lucia and the French Republic)

8. Free Zone (Amendment)

9. Child (Care, Protection and Adoption)

10. Child Justice

Tuesday’s Sitting is scheduled to commence at 10:00 a.m.

The Sitting of the Senate is scheduled for Thursday, Nov. 22, 2018 at 10 a.m.
